Version control systems allow teams to safely make changes in code over time without worrying about losing important changes. Thus, it keeps a history of written code.
Version control systems are software that allows teams to create and manage databases of code called repositories . These snapshots are stored so that teams can easily revert between versions of code, and pull or push out different versions out simultaneously. Code can be stored in independent containers called branches for different purposes or people . With GitHub and bash scripting, tools can be downloaded or written to automate several processes.
So you've been working on some cool visualization pipeline or new machine learning algorithm that can help a bunch of people in lab, is necessary for a programming project, or is the software package you're publishing.
You can send the source code files by email or Google Drive. But what if you and others wanted to make changes that would make the software even more useful? Or worse - other people have already contributed to your code, creating several versions of the same file and you want to get the best version out to the public. How can you compile all of these different file versions to one (hopefully) working script?
These are just a few of the many positive aspects of version control. For a more in-depth discussion, you can read the official documentation (which I highly encourage you to do), but this repository is meant to be a functional guide to quickly using Git and GitHub for your research project.
There are so many introductory tutorials for using Git and GitHub. This can be daunting to read through, compile, and quickly apply to research projects.
The goal of this repository is to create a concise, step-by-step resource for maintaining your software projects on GitHub that you can apply in a couple of minutes to a few hours after learning the basics. This is specifically catered towards projects in the Chandrasekaran lab.
